Do you wake in the middle of the night, wondering…why you’re so unhappy? Here are 8 signs you may be unhappy with your life:

  1. You aren’t sure what to do with your time. When we are flowing and connected to purpose, we always have an abundance of energy and ideas for what we want to take on next. A dearth of ideas could mean you aren’t happy with what you are doing and need to switch things up a bit.
  2. You binge TV and movies- binging can happen for a variety of reasons- from a habitual resistance to unstructured boredom, to a deep core wound of loneliness, or self disrespect that haunts the binger day in and day out. Whichever the case, repeatedly binging, especially if you are tuning out or not even appreciating the movie or show is a sign of a lack of purpose and passion in one’s life.
  3. Your pro-social personality suddenly becomes anti-social or neutrally social. Were you once a social butterfly, or at least the initiator in social arrangements? A sudden withdrawal from social contact could be a sign that you are withdrawing from life, and not happy with your circumstances.
  4. You feel a dull ache where your heart and emotions used to live- feeling disconnected from our emotions and purpose can take a variety of forms. Some people go into fight or flight when their life isn’t going the way they hope or want it to. Feeling disconnected from feelings is a big sign that you are not flowing with your purpose.
  5. Your earning power is stuck- this one is a bit controversial for me to write. I don’t believe we should mark our progress in life by how much money we make, however when things are stalled financially- it could be another sign we are not living in our joy.
  6. You feel you have lost the “vision” for your life. Having a vision for your life is very important. Without a vision, we often perish and fall victim to low ideas and low energies-redefining our purpose, and taking actions that contribute to our well-being and thus purpose will help us get back on track.
  7. You keep reaching for more unhealthy habits-this is a tough one for a lot of people. As they lose track of their purpose, vision, and joy they begin to try to substitute with activities that may even send them further into muddled territory. People sometimes overdraw their bank accounts at this point trying to figure out what will improve their mood or situation.
